The Jain Deemed-to-be University in Bangalore's Faculty of Engineering and Technology (FET) has a good infrastructure, industry partnerships, and a variety of M.Tech programs. There are, however, several drawbacks, including expensive tuition fee, lower placement rates and average packages than B.Tech degrees, and no publicly available data on M.Tech student outcomes and placements. Overall, the college is fine for M.Tech, however, it is good for B.Tech. You must evaluate all the options before selecting any college.

The Faculty of Engineering and Technology (FET) at Jain Deemed-to-be University, Bangalore has a good placement record for B.Tech programs, but assessing M.Tech placements is more challenging due to limited publicly available data. The university website and third-party resources like Shiksha offer scarce or absent data specifically on M.Tech placements. A lower placement rate for M.Tech programs compared to B.Tech at FET is reported, with a 2023 placement rate of 10.64%.M.Tech placements tend to be lower across universities, due to factors such as a smaller pool of M.Tech-specific recruiters, a focus on research and academics, and individual factors like research experience, industry readiness, and individual student skills. To learn more about M.Tech placements, contact the admissions office or placement cell or talk to current students or alumni at FET.When choosing an M.Tech program, consider factors such as programme curriculum and specialization, faculty expertise and research opportunities, and infrastructure and learning environment. By thoroughly evaluating these aspects, you can choose the M.Tech programme that best suits your academic and career aspirations, regardless of solely focusing on placement statistics.

The Faculty of Engineering and Technology (FET) at Jain Deemed-to-be University, Bangalore rankings are given below:It was ranked 115th among engineering institutions in India according to NIRF in 2023.Jain University was ranked 86th under Management in 2023.It does not, however, appear frequently in global university rankings such as the Times Higher Education World University Rankings or the QS World University Rankings. That's why it has been regarded as a Tier 3 college.

The fee bifurcation for B.Tech at Faculty of Engineering and Technology, Jain Deemed-to-be University is given below:Tuition Fee: INR 3.9 lakhs to 13.8 Lakhs for the whole course depending upon the specializationsHostel Fee: INR 6.70 LakhOne-time payment: INR 20,000So the total fee starts from 10.76 Lakhs to 20 Lakhs for a 4 year course, depending upon the specialization selected.

The fee bifurcation for M.Tech at Faculty of Engineering and Technology, Jain Deemed-to-be University is given below:Tuition Fee: INR 3.5 lakhs to 4.2 Lakhs for the whole course depending upon the specializationsHostel Fee: INR 3.40 LakhOne-time payment: INR 20,000So the total fee starts from 7.10 Lakhs to 10 Lakhs for a 2 year course, depending upon the specialization selected.

The Faculty of Engineering and Technology (FET) at Jain Deemed-to-be University, Bangalore, has a strong placement record, but identifying the exact branch with the highest number of placements is challenging due to limited publicly available data. However, the placements in B.Tech. in Computer Science and Engineering are comparatively better, Because the demand for IT is increasing in the market. However, every course in this college has a unique value, like B.Tech. in Aeronautical Engineering, B.Tech. in Metallurgical and Materials Engineering and many more, are the courses which have high demand in the market. Recruitment also depends upon various factors such as individual skills, academic performance, industry trends, the quality of training and internships offered by the university, and networking abilities.

The tuition fees for the M.Tech programme in Food Technology at FET are INR 3.50-4.20 Lakhs for the entire programme duration, depending upon the specializations you choose. The bifurcation is given below:Tuition Fee: INR 3.50-4.20 Lakhs (according to specialization)Hostel Fee: INR 3.40 LakhOne-Time Payment: INR 20,000The above fees exclude exam fees, practical fees etc. Expenses on book and transportation are also excluded.

Which one is better for a BSc, Symbiosis School of Economics or BSc, Christ University Bangalore?

Both are top colleges, but, it is your choice. If your planning to pursue your Masters programme in foreign countries then opt for Symbiosis. Because there are programs which will make you feasible in that attire. But, if not, then Christ university is best. Both are top colleges.Faculty and placements in Symbiosis school of economics has the good faculty and impressive placements. Reputed companies like Microsoft, Google, Times Now and consulting firms actively recruite SSE students. Average CTC for SSE placement is around INR 6-7 LPA. Christ university also has notable placements, with companies like Accenture, KPMG, Kotak Bank and other hiring its students. The average salary is INR 7LPAInfrastructure and environment at SSE is a mix of positives and limitations. Christ university provides a vibrant campus environment with extracurricular activities.

Is there placement in Bangalore University?

Yes, the University has a placement cell that conducts various activities for the successful placement of the students. The official data for the recent placements is not out yet. However, the NIRF report 2024 has been released, according to which 317 UG (4-year), 52 UG (5-year), and 1,429 PG (2-year) students were placed during the 2023 drive. Further, the median package offered to UG (4-year) and UG (5-year) students was INR 6.50 LPA and INR 7.45 LPA. For PG (2-year) courses, the median package stood at INR 2.50 LPA.

To be eligible for the admission to B.Tech at the Faculty of Engineering and Technology (FET), Jain (Deemed-to-be University), Bangalore, the candidate must pass a 10+2 examination with Physics and Mathematics as compulsory subjects, along with one of Chemistry, Electronics, Computer Science, or Biology. The minimum marks for the general category are 45% marks (40% for SC/ST) in the 12th from a recognized board. Candidates are required to appear for one of the following entrance exams: KCET, COMEDK UGET or JET (Jain Entrance Test). The selection is done based on entrance exam scores, counselling, document verification, and final selection based on entrance exam scores and other relevant factors.The application deadline for the 2024-2025 academic year is March 25, 2024.
